Holy Thursday - Wielki Czwartek
In the days of the monarchy it was a custom for the King and a Bishop to wash the feet of twelve beggars especially chosen for this occasion, symbolizing the spirit of penance, charity, and humility by those in authority.
In the Church of Our Lady of Czestochowa promptly at 4 A.M. the miraculous picture of Our Lady is ceremoniously cleaned, dusted and receives a change of dress.  Religious objects are touched to the picture to impart to them a measure of the picture's supernatural powers.  This is usually a private ceremony conducted in a small chapel at the monastery.
In the parish churches, one of the side altars is elaborately decorated with linens and flowers and prepared for adoration of the Blessed Sacrament.  This altar configures the prison cell in which Christ was kept after His trail.
